Transaction 3155a29db41f04e93a7d2c95540843405681600a585071152c41931bbfac81e6

1 Input
2 Outputs
  • 3155a29db41f04e93a7d2c95540843405681600a585071152c41931bbfac81e6:0
  • value  2827519
    address  36b9rPgwrdCmuaeXvGgyuexR6A8jLLkELj
  • 3155a29db41f04e93a7d2c95540843405681600a585071152c41931bbfac81e6:1
  • value  57112696
    address  bc1qunghp4757hjpevxf72tcqnj2nmfdu00wp72747